[#] SRELL 4.069 — библиотека ECMAScript-совместимых регулярных выражений
robot(spnet, 1) — All
2025-09-11 11:44:04


10 сентября состоялся выпуск 4.069 C++ библиотеки [ SRELL ]( https://www.akenotsuki.com/misc/srell/en ) (Std::RegEx-Like Library), реализующей [ ECMAScript-совместимые регулярные выражения ]( https://tc39.es/ecma262/multipage/text-processing.html#sec-regexp-regular-expression-objects ) .

[ Основные возможности библиотеки ]( https://www.akenotsuki.com/misc/srell/en/#features ) :

• header-only;

• ECMAScript-совместимые регулярные выражения;

• дизайн а-ля std::regex;

• поддержка типов char8_t, char16_t и char32_t для C++11 и более поздних версий стандарта C++;

• [ возможность компиляции без использования исключений ]( https://www.akenotsuki.com/misc/srell/en/#no_throw ) C++;

• [ использование инструкций SIMD ]( https://www.akenotsuki.com/misc/srell/en/#simd ) SSE 4.2, с определением их наличия во время исполнения;

• [ большое количество вспомогательных функций и классов ]( https://www.akenotsuki.com/misc/srell/en/#regex_search ) : match, search, match_results, replace, split_* и др.

( [ читать дальше... ]( https://www.linux.org.ru/news/development/18076735#cut ) )

[ Прошлая новость на ЛОРе ]( https://www.linux.org.ru/news/development/17732507 )